President Bush to Make Up Missed National Guard Duty This Weekend
The Onion
WASHINGTON, DC—In a move intended to dispel criticism over his Vietnam-era military record, President Bush announced Monday that he will spend the weekend at the Sheppard Air Force Base in Wichita Falls, TX, to make up his missed National Guard service....

"I had to cancel dozens of appointments with cabinet members, congressional leaders, and foreign dignitaries," Bush said. "All that stuff’s going to have to wait, since this 30-year-old story is apparently a pressing national concern, or something." ....

At a press conference Monday afternoon, a reporter asked White House press secretary Scott McClellan why Bush wasn’t making up his time in Alabama, where critics say he failed to report for drills during the entire time he was working on a family friend’s U.S. Senate campaign.

"Well, the president is familiar with the base in Texas, so he chose to do his service there," McClellan said....
